Praseodymium/Polyureasulfone Complexes with Unusual Thermal, Luminescent and Magnetic Properties

Sunjie Ye、Fang Li、Yun Lu 等 5 位作者2010-04-07Macromolecular Chemistry and Physics

Abstract A soluble praseodymium complex was synthesized using a polymeric PUDS ligand. FTIR and Raman spectra suggest that the >NH lone pair in PUDS can interact with the Pr3+ centers. PNSXM 2009: Workshop on Polarized Neutrons and Synchrotron X-rays for Magnetism

Raphaël P. Hermann、Ulrich Rücker、Manuel Angst2010-04-07Synchrotron Radiation News

The second Workshop on Polarized Neutrons and Synchrotron X-rays for Magnetism (PNSXM 2009) took place in Bonn (Germany) from August 2 to 5, 2009, as a satellite conference to the ICM 2009 in Karlsruhe (Germany). Branching Patterns and Stepped Leaders in an Electric-Circuit Model for Creeping Discharge

Hidetsugu Sakaguchi、Sahim M. Kourkouss2010-04-07arXiv (Cornell University)

We construct a two-dimensional electric circuit model for creeping discharge. Two types of discharge, surface corona and surface leader, are modeled by a two-step function of conductance.
